HTML (HyperText Markup Language) – это язык разметки, который используется для создания веб-страниц. HTML позволяет создавать структуру и содержимое веб-страницы, такие как заголовки, абзацы, изображения, ссылки и многое другое. В этой статье мы рассмотрим, что такое HTML более подробно, включая его историю, основные элементы, преимущества и недостатки.
История HTML
HTML был разработан в 1990 году Тимом Бернерсом-Ли, который в то время работал в организации CERN (Европейская организация ядерных исследований). Бернерс-Ли хотел создать простой способ обмена информацией между учеными, работающими в разных университетах и исследовательских центрах.
Он создал HTML как часть проекта World Wide Web (WWW), который включал в себя и другие технологии, такие как HTTP (Hypertext Transfer Protocol) и URL (Uniform Resource Locator). Вместе эти технологии обеспечили основу для веб-браузеров и веб-серверов, которые мы используем сегодня.
С тех пор HTML прошел много изменений и развитий. В настоящее время используется последняя версия HTML5, которая включает в себя множество новых функций и возможностей для создания более интерактивных и сложных веб-приложений.
Основные элементы HTML
HTML состоит из множества элементов, которые используются для создания различных частей веб-страницы. Ниже приведены некоторые из основных элементов HTML:
Теги
HTML использует теги для определения различных элементов веб-страницы, таких как заголовки, абзацы, изображения и т.д. Каждый тег состоит из открывающей и закрывающей частей, которые обрамляют содержимое элемента. Например, тег для создания заголовка выглядит так:
<h1>Заголовок</h1>
Открывающий тег <h1> определяет начало заголовка, а закрывающий тег </h1> – его конец.
Атрибуты
HTML также использует атрибуты для указания дополнительной информации о элементах. Например, атрибут src используется для указания пути к изображению, а атрибут href – для создания ссылки.
Атрибуты добавляются к открывающему тегу и обычно имеют вид “имя_атрибута=значение”. Например, для добавления изображения на страницу, нужно использовать тег <img>, атрибут src для указания пути к файлу с изображением, и необязательный атрибут alt для добавления альтернативного текста, который отобразится в случае, если изображение не будет загружено:
<img src="путь/к/изображению.jpg" alt="Описание изображения">
Элементы формы
HTML предоставляет возможность создавать элементы формы, такие как текстовые поля, флажки, переключатели и т.д., которые позволяют пользователям отправлять данные на сервер. Например, чтобы создать текстовое поле для ввода имени, нужно использовать тег <input> с атрибутом type=”text”:
<label for="name">Имя:</label><input type="text" id="name" name="name">
Здесь мы также добавили атрибут id для идентификации элемента и атрибут name для указания имени поля, которое будет использоваться при отправке данных на сервер.
Ссылки
HTML позволяет создавать ссылки на другие веб-страницы, файлы и ресурсы. Для этого используется тег <a>:
<a href="путь/к/другой/странице.html">Текст ссылки</a>
Здесь мы используем атрибут href для указания пути к странице, на которую должна вести ссылка, и добавляем текст ссылки между открывающим и закрывающим тегами.
Преимущества HTML
HTML имеет несколько преимуществ, которые делают его популярным среди веб-разработчиков:
Простота использования
HTML легко понять и использовать даже для начинающих разработчиков. Он имеет простую структуру и интуитивно понятный синтаксис, что позволяет быстро создавать веб-страницы.
Кросс-платформенность
HTML может быть использован на любой платформе и с любым веб-браузером. Это означает, что веб-страницы, созданные с помощью HTML, будут выглядеть одинаково на любом устройстве и в любом браузере.
SEO-оптимизация
HTML предоставляет множество возможностей для оптимизации веб-страниц для поисковых систем. Например, использование правильной структуры HTML-документа, использование соответствующих тегов и атрибутов, а также правильное использование заголовков и ключевых слов может помочь повысить рейтинг веб-страницы в поисковой выдаче.
Возможности стилизации
HTML позволяет добавлять CSS-стили к веб-страницам, что позволяет создавать красивый и современный дизайн для сайтов.
Поддержка мультимедиа
HTML поддерживает множество мультимедийных элементов, таких как изображения, аудио и видео. Это позволяет создавать более интерактивные и привлекательные веб-страницы.
Поддержка мобильных устройств
HTML позволяет создавать адаптивные веб-страницы, которые будут хорошо выглядеть на любом устройстве, включая мобильные телефоны и планшеты.
Ключевые слова HTML
Некоторые из ключевых слов, связанных с HTML, включают в себя:
- теги HTML
- атрибуты HTML
- элементы формы
- ссылки HTML
- структура HTML-документа
- заголовки HTML
- CSS-стили
- мультимедиа-элементы HTML
- адаптивный дизайн HTML
Важность HTML для веб-разработки
HTML является основой веб-разработки и является важным элементом для создания любого веб-сайта. Веб-страницы, созданные с помощью HTML, являются базовой единицей веб-сайта и содержат информацию, которую пользователи могут увидеть и взаимодействовать с ней.
HTML также является неотъемлемой частью веб-стандартов и поддерживается всеми веб-браузерами. Это означает, что веб-страницы, созданные с помощью HTML, будут выглядеть одинаково на всех устройствах и во всех браузерах.
Кроме того, HTML важен для SEO-оптимизации веб-страниц и может помочь улучшить рейтинг веб-сайта в поисковой выдаче.
Выводы
HTML является базовым языком веб-разработки и играет важную роль в создании любого веб-сайта. Он имеет простую структуру и интуитивно понятный синтаксис, что делает его легко понятным даже для начинающих разработчиков.
HTML предоставляет разработчикам возможность создавать структурированный контент, добавлять мультимедийные элементы, стилизовать веб-страницы и создавать адаптивный дизайн для мобильных устройств.
Ключевые слова HTML, такие как теги, атрибуты, элементы формы, ссылки, структура HTML-документа, заголовки, CSS-стили, мультимедиа-элементы и адаптивный дизайн, играют важную роль в создании веб-сайтов и могут помочь улучшить рейтинг веб-страниц в поисковых системах.
HTML является неотъемлемой частью веб-стандартов и поддерживается всеми веб-браузерами, что делает его необходимым инструментом для создания веб-сайтов.В целом, HTML является важным языком веб-разработки и любой, кто заинтересован в создании веб-сайтов, должен освоить его основы и научиться использовать его для создания качественного и профессионального контента для своих веб-страниц.